
Italian Dressing
Ingredients
- ¼ cup extra-virgin olive oil
- 2 tablespoons Balsamic vinegar
- 2 tablespoons lemon juice
- 1 tablespoon finely chopped fresh parsley
- 1 teaspoon honey
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1 garlic clove
grated
- ½ teaspoon Dijon mustard
- ½ teaspoon thyme
- ¼ teaspoon sea salt
- Freshly ground black pepper
- 2 tablespoons Parmesan cheese
optional
Directions
- 1
In a small bowl, whisk together the oil, vinegar, lemon juice, parsley, honey, oregano, garlic, mustard, thyme, salt, and pepper.
- 2
If desired, stir in the cheese.

About this Recipe
Tired of bland store-bought dressings that lack vibrancy? Elevate your everyday meals with this simple yet sophisticated homemade Italian dressing, crafted to bring fresh, zesty flavor to your table in just 5 minutes.
This dressing truly shines with its bright, balanced blend of flavors. The tang of Balsamic vinegar and fresh lemon juice provides a delightful counterpoint to the rich extra-virgin olive oil. A subtle touch of honey mellows the acidity, while grated garlic, dried oregano, and thyme infuse the dressing with classic Italian aromatics, making it far superior to anything from a bottle.

This versatile dressing can be easily customized to fit your preferences. For a dairy-free version, simply omit the Parmesan cheese. You can also adjust the amount of honey to suit your desired level of sweetness, or increase the grated garlic for a bolder, more pungent kick.
Perfect for drizzling over fresh garden salads, marinating chicken or vegetables before grilling, or as a vibrant sauce for grilled fish. It's an excellent choice for a quick weeknight dinner or to enhance a special occasion meal.
